[DOCS] Inconsistency between `--fallback-model` flag restrictions and "Max User" fallback behavior
Documentation Type
Unclear/confusing documentation
Documentation Location
- https://code.claude.com/docs/en/cli-reference - https://code.claude.com/docs/en/costs - https://code.claude.com/docs/en/model-config
Section/Topic
The usage requirements for automatic model fallback, specifically distinguishing between the --fallback-model CLI flag and the built-in fallback behavior for Max/Pro subscribers.
Current Documentation
From CLI Reference:
--fallback-model | Enable automatic fallback to specified model when default model is overloaded (print mode only)
From Manage costs effectively:
For certain Max users, Claude Code will automatically fall back to Sonnet if you hit a usage threshold with Opus.
From Model configuration (default model setting):
For certain Max users, Claude Code will automatically fall back to Sonnet if you hit a usage threshold with Opus.
What's Wrong or Missing?
There is a contradiction regarding whether model fallback is restricted to "print mode" (non-interactive).
- The CLI Reference explicitly labels the
--fallback-modelflag as "(print mode only)." - The Costs and Model Configuration pages describe a fallback from Opus to Sonnet for Max users as a general feature, implying it works in standard interactive sessions.
It is unclear if the "Max user" fallback is a separate internal mechanism that does work in interactive mode, or if all forms of model fallback are strictly limited to print mode. If the latter is true, interactive users hitting a threshold or encountering an overloaded model might be confused when an automatic fallback does not occur.
Suggested Improvement
Clarify the scope of fallback behavior in the Costs and Model Config sections.
Suggested addition to Manage costs effectively:
"For certain Max users, Claude Code will automatically fall back to Sonnet if you hit a usage threshold with Opus. Note: In interactive mode, this fallback occurs [automatically/only after a prompt]; for automated scripts using the CLI, use the --fallback-model flag (available in print mode only)."
Alternatively, if the Max user fallback only works in print mode, the Costs section should be updated to say:
"For certain Max users running in print mode (-p), Claude Code will automatically fall back to Sonnet..."
